The Facts Behind Anabolic Steroids

Anabolic steroids are synthetic derivatives of testosterone, designed to promote muscle growth, strength, and endurance. While they can offer significant physical benefits, their use is surrounded by controversy. Here are some key facts:

  1. Performance Enhancement: Many professional athletes have turned to anabolic steroids to gain a competitive edge. Their ability to increase muscle mass and recovery time is well documented.
  2. Health Risks: The long-term use of these substances can lead to severe health complications, including liver damage, hormonal imbalances, and cardiovascular issues.
  3. Testing and Regulation: Most professional sports organizations have strict regulations against the use of steroids. Athletes are often subjected to random drug testing to ensure fair play.
  4. Public Perception: While many fans are aware of doping scandals, the actual prevalence of steroid use in professional sports remains uncertain, leading to myths and misunderstandings.
